Market Overview

The Global Bulk Filtration Market is projected to grow from USD 13.83 Billion in 2025 to USD 19.81 Billion by 2031 at a 6.17% CAGR. Bulk filtration encompasses the mechanical separation of suspended particulates and contaminants from large volumes of industrial process fluids, including fuels, lubricants, hydraulic oils, and water. This fundamental process is vital for preserving equipment longevity, ensuring product purity, and upholding operational reliability across diverse manufacturing and marine sectors. The market’s growth is primarily driven by accelerating global industrialization, expanding urbanization, and the increasing imperative for environmental compliance, with stricter regulatory frameworks compelling industries to implement advanced purification systems.

A significant impediment to market expansion is the inherent high operational and maintenance expenditure associated with specialized bulk filtration systems. Addressing complex contamination profiles often requires tailored, resource-intensive solutions. According to the American Water Works Association, in its 2025 State of the Water Industry report, only 41 percent of utilities expressed full confidence in their ability to maintain infrastructure, indicating a persistent demand for robust filtration technologies.

Key Market Drivers

Global Industrial Expansion and Urbanization
Global Industrial Expansion and Urbanization significantly propels the bulk filtration market by increasing the scale and complexity of industrial operations and urban infrastructure. As industries such as manufacturing, chemicals, and energy expand globally, the demand for precise fluid purity across process streams intensifies to protect equipment longevity and maintain product quality. Urbanization concurrently drives growth in municipal services, including enhanced water and wastewater infrastructure, which rely heavily on efficient bulk filtration systems to manage larger volumes of fluids and contaminants. This ongoing industrialization necessitates robust filtration for raw material processing, intermediate production, and final product conditioning. According to ISM's Supply Chain Planning Forecast, December 2025, manufacturing revenues were projected to increase by approximately 4.4% in 2026, indicating a continued need for advanced filtration solutions within an expanding industrial landscape.

Water Scarcity and Wastewater Treatment
The growing imperatives of water scarcity and wastewater treatment further stimulate the bulk filtration market. Depleting freshwater resources and stricter environmental discharge regulations compel industries and municipalities to adopt sophisticated filtration technologies for water recycling, reuse, and effective effluent management. Bulk filtration systems are fundamental in removing suspended solids, organic matter, and other pollutants from industrial wastewater streams before discharge or further advanced treatment processes, safeguarding environmental ecosystems. For instance, according to KVUE, April 2026, the city of Austin broke ground on a $1.5 billion expansion of its Walnut Creek Wastewater Treatment Plant, highlighting substantial investments in improving wastewater treatment capacity. Reflecting the broader investment in this sector, according to Industria Partners, in 2026, CRH entered an agreement to acquire Axius Water, a provider of specialized water quality solutions, for $700 million.

Key Market Challenges

The high operational and maintenance expenditure associated with specialized bulk filtration systems presents a significant impediment to the growth of the Global Bulk Filtration Market. These systems, essential for managing complex contamination profiles, often necessitate tailored and resource-intensive solutions. The substantial ongoing costs for consumables, spare parts, and specialized labor directly increase the total cost of ownership for these critical technologies.

This elevated cost burden directly hampers market expansion by deterring potential industrial end-users from investing in advanced bulk filtration solutions. Faced with increasing operational expenses, companies may defer necessary upgrades or opt for less effective, lower-cost alternatives that do not fully meet purity or longevity requirements. According to the National Association of Manufacturers, in its Q2 2025 Manufacturers' Outlook Survey, respondents expected raw material prices and other input costs to increase by 5.8% on average over the subsequent year, representing a significant financial pressure on manufacturing operations. Such rising input costs for materials vital to filtration system upkeep make long-term planning and budgeting more challenging, consequently slowing the adoption of robust bulk filtration technologies.

Key Market Trends

The integration of smart filtration technologies represents a significant trend, transforming bulk filtration from a reactive process into a proactive and predictive operation. This involves deploying advanced sensors, real-time monitoring, and data analytics to optimize efficiency, anticipate maintenance, and reduce downtime. Such systems offer enhanced control over filtration parameters, leading to more consistent fluid purity and improved operational reliability. The adoption of these intelligent solutions allows industries to move towards condition-based monitoring, extending media lifespan and reducing operational expenditures. According to The Business Research Company, in its March 2026 report, the industrial control for process automation market was expected to grow from $41.44 billion in 2025 to $45.56 billion in 2026, representing a compound annual growth rate of 9.9%. This demonstrates a clear market shift towards digitally enabled filtration solutions.

Another prominent trend shaping the global bulk filtration market is the pronounced shift towards sustainable and eco-friendly filtration solutions. This involves developing and adopting technologies that minimize environmental impact throughout their lifecycle, including recyclable or biodegradable materials. Industries increasingly seek filtration systems promoting water reuse, reducing chemical waste, and lowering energy footprints, aligning with sustainability goals and regulatory pressures. This emphasis extends to solutions offering extended service intervals, further reducing waste generation. According to the WateReuse Association, in its April 2026 report on the Industrial Water Solutions conference, a national shift toward circular water practices could unlock up to $47 billion annually in direct economic value for U.S. water utilities and municipalities. This indicates a growing market preference for environmentally responsible filtration practices.

Segmental Insights

The Cartridge Filters segment is experiencing rapid growth within the Global Bulk Filtration Market, driven by its inherent advantages and evolving industry demands. This segment's expansion is primarily attributed to the increasing need for efficient filtration solutions across diverse sectors, including industrial processes and water purification. Cartridge filters offer benefits such as straightforward installation, minimal maintenance requirements, and effective removal of particulate contaminants. Furthermore, the rising awareness of water quality and safety, coupled with stringent regulatory pressures from bodies focused on environmental protection, compel industries to adopt these systems for consistent performance and compliance.

Regional Insights

North America holds a leading position in the Global Bulk Filtration Market, distinguished by its technologically advanced industrial infrastructure and robust regulatory framework. The United States spearheads regional demand due to its substantial oil and gas, pharmaceutical, food, and chemical processing industries, which necessitate high-purity processing and contaminant-free fluids. Environmental bodies like the U.S. Environmental Protection Agency (EPA) enforce strict regulations on industrial effluents and emissions, compelling industries to adopt sophisticated bulk filtration solutions for compliance and sustainability. This focus on quality standards and environmental accountability reinforces North America's market leadership.

Recent Developments

  • In May 2026, Donaldson, a prominent company in engine and industrial filtration, completed the acquisition of Facet Filtration. This strategic move expanded Donaldson's comprehensive line of filtration offerings, particularly enhancing its capabilities in bulk tank filtration. The integration of Facet Filtration’s technologies aimed to strengthen Donaldson's position in supporting essential OEM systems that operate across various heavy industries. This acquisition underscores Donaldson’s commitment to providing advanced filtration solutions that protect critical equipment and contribute to cleaner industrial processes within the global bulk filtration market.
  • In December 2025, Schroeder Industries introduced several innovations aimed at enhancing industrial filtration efficiency and sustainability. Among these was the Sustainable Cartridge Bowl (SCB), an alternative to traditional spin-on filters designed to significantly reduce waste. The company also launched its TNK Series TNK1C Reservoir, a compact and durable solution engineered for optimized flow and effective filtration in hydraulic systems. Additionally, the GeoSeal® High-Flow Coalescing Filter – Duplex was unveiled, offering improved performance for bulk fuel filtration and high-horsepower applications, further addressing demanding operational environments within the global bulk filtration market.
  • In November 2025, Parker Hannifin Corporation, a global leader in motion and control technologies, announced its plan to acquire Filtration Group Corporation for $9.25 billion. This strategic acquisition was set to significantly expand Parker Hannifin's industrial filtration capabilities, positioning it as one of the largest global industrial filtration businesses. The integration of Filtration Group’s proprietary media and application expertise was expected to enhance Parker Hannifin’s ability to serve customers globally. The transaction, subject to regulatory approvals, aimed to create substantial cost synergies and accelerate growth within the bulk filtration sector.
  • In October 2025, Cleanova, a global provider of engineered filtration solutions, announced the introduction of new PFAS-Free Media Coalescing Filters. This product launch directly addresses the increasing demand for sustainable gas filtration technologies. The filters were developed to meet stringent environmental regulations by eliminating per- and polyfluoroalkyl substances (PFAS) from the filtration media, ensuring cleaner industrial gas streams. This innovation reflects the company's commitment to advancing environmentally responsible solutions within the bulk filtration market, particularly for industries requiring high-performance and compliant gas purification systems.
